SAHMs Don't Have it Easy: New Tee Validating the Hard Work of Stay-at-home Moms Goes Viral Overnight
NEW YORK, July 28, 2016 /PRNewswire/ -- Less than 24 hours after KreadivKlothing founder Arielle Hall posted a photo of her company's first t-shirt on the new KreadivKlothing Facebook page, the shirt has gone viral with nearly 1,200 likes and more than 200 shares. What's behind the buzz? It's the t-shirt's message. Proclaiming "SAHMs DON'T HAVE IT EASY (IT'S CALLED 'HARD WORK')," KreadivKlothing's debut product has touched on something powerful among stay-at-home moms: the knowledge that their job is no walk in the park.

The "SAHMs DON'T HAVE IT EASY" shirt appears to have struck a chord among at-home moms, with many Facebook commenters tagging friends and family members. "I worked for 12 years and maintained a clean house [and] did dinner for my family," said one Facebook commenter. "For me it was easier to work full-time and do mom duties than to be a SAHM, which I am now."
Those are the sentiments expressed by many of the stay-at-home moms and former stay-at-home moms she knows, says Hall. "I created the shirt from personal experience. I think stay-at-home moms are often discounted as lazy or viewed as having it easier than their working counterparts, but in truth, staying at home with children full-time is real work. It can be mentally, emotionally, and physically draining."
Hall cautioned that her company is not about pitting working moms against at-home moms: Both groups, she says, are doing the work of raising the next generation, and that's what counts. "At KreadivKlothing we believe every mom works, whether she's primarily doing so outside the home or inside the home," she said. "With our first shirt, we're acknowledging that stay-at-home moms rarely get the validation that, yes, their job is work. It's a labor of love, to be sure, but it is still hard work."
So far, over a thousand people agree with Hall. If the first 24 hours of the "SAHMs DON'T HAVE IT EASY" Teespring campaign are any indication, many more moms feel the same.
